    Description

    Three great resources on John Marsden's, 'Tomorrow, When the War Began' ready to print and use. A printable novel study student booklet and teacher’s plan, essay writing workshop, and 20 great quote posters for reference and English classroom decor.

    Everything you need to pick up and run with this novel, prepare for exams, and decorate as well, with some great-looking quote posters to add easy reference material and an attractive display.

    So easy!

    Suits English Language Arts students of approximately 13-16 years of age.


    **********************************************************

    3 Great Resources Included:

    • 23-page student booklet for analysis of Tomorrow, When the War Began
    • 24-page student booklet for essay writing
    • 20 quote posters.

    Standards

    to see state-specific standards (only available in the US).
    Cite strong and thorough textual evidence to support analysis of what the text says explicitly as well as inferences drawn from the text.
    Determine a theme or central idea of a text and analyze in detail its development over the course of the text, including how it emerges and is shaped and refined by specific details; provide an objective summary of the text.
    Analyze how complex characters (e.g., those with multiple or conflicting motivations) develop over the course of a text, interact with other characters, and advance the plot or develop the theme.
    Determine the meaning of words and phrases as they are used in the text, including figurative and connotative meanings; analyze the cumulative impact of specific word choices on meaning and tone (e.g., how the language evokes a sense of time and place; how it sets a formal or informal tone).
    Analyze how an author’s choices concerning how to structure a text, order events within it (e.g., parallel plots), and manipulate time (e.g., pacing, flashbacks) create such effects as mystery, tension, or surprise.
